Emilio Estrada Carmona (born May 28, 1855 – died December 21, 1911) was a very important person in the history of Ecuador. He served as the President of Ecuador for a short time in 1911. He was in office from September 1 until December 21, 1911.
Sadly, Emilio Estrada died while he was still president. He passed away on December 21, 1911, in Quito, Ecuador. He was 56 years old when he died. His death was caused by problems with his heart.

The Election of 1911
In 1911, Emilio Estrada was elected as the President of Ecuador. This was a significant event for him and for the country. People had high hopes for his leadership. He officially started his term on September 1, 1911.
A Short Term in Office
Emilio Estrada's time as president was very brief. He served for only a few months. His presidency ended suddenly when he passed away. This happened on December 21, 1911. His death meant that a new leader had to be chosen quickly.
